The Service Interface for Real Time Information or SIRI is an XML protocol to allow distributed computers to exchange real time information about public transport services and vehicles.

Steering a client device to a server in a cluster of servers

Predictive Control Methods and Systems Based on Road Adhesion Coefficient

ActiveCN121671565BTime informationAdhesion coefficient
This application relates to the field of vehicle control technology and discloses a predictive control method and system based on road surface adhesion coefficient. In this method, a cloud server acquires real-time information uploaded by vehicles on the road. The cloud server can combine the real-time information with historical information from each grid to form a road surface adhesion coefficient matrix. The cloud server sends the road surface adhesion coefficient matrix to the vehicle. Based on the road surface adhesion coefficient matrix, the vehicle's current position, and navigation path, the vehicle determines the predicted road surface adhesion coefficient value in its current direction of travel. Based on the predicted road surface adhesion coefficient value, the vehicle calculates the upper limit of its regenerative braking capacity and / or the upper limit of its driving torque, and then controls the vehicle accordingly. The beneficial effect is improved vehicle control efficiency on low-adhesion roads.
